Has anyone found any pitting on their Jeep? I believe it’s the most evident on white. Dealership says in rail dirt? It’s really irritating. This is the last passenger side window. Their are a few on the roll bars as well.

9B499FA4-520E-4F70-AD54-869F6A300483.jpeg
Wow! That looks like 100% factory issue. There looks to be contamination under the paint in your picture. Small black dots with paint over them where you can see the paint distorted from the raised surface. One of the spots even looks like it may be rust coming through the surface of the paint. If your dealer is throwing it back on you I would request the number to contact your local FCA Rep. Also contacting Jeep Cares on this forum might help as well.
